The Wausau River District is seeking candidates for the Executive Director position located in Wausau, Wisconsin. This individual will be responsible for the overall administration and management of the Wausau River District. The individual will coordinate projects, programs, and policies within a downtown revitalization program that focuses on historic preservation and downtown economic development. Areas of responsibility include fundraising, program development and execution, planning and evaluation, advocacy for policy change, personnel and fiscal management, public relations, marketing, and special event coordination. This is a hybrid role; three days in office required and two days may be remote.
The individual must be entrepreneurial-minded, energetic, imaginative, well-organized, and capable of functioning effectively in an independent environment, using excellent written and verbal communication skills with all employees and stakeholders. In addition, they will maintain the highest level of morale, personal and professional growth, motivation and performance with each staff member.
QUALIFICATIONS
Associate’s degree required. Bachelor’s degree preferred.
A minimum of 3 years’ experience in business management, organizational leadership, event planning, or related experience.
Previous experience with a main street program preferred.
Previous experience leading a team strongly preferred.
Proficient with Microsoft Office and Windows programs.
Familiarity with Quicken and/or QuickBooks preferred.
Strong communication skills, verbal and written.
Ability to communicate and work with the public and willingness to gain knowledge and understanding
needs of businesses and property owners within the River District.
Ability to effectively manage projects following appropriate timelines.
TOTAL REWARDS
The starting salary for this position is $65,000 per year, commensurate with qualifications and experience.Health Reimbursement Account, Monthly Lifestyle Benefit, Monthly River District Benefit, Employer Roth IRA Contribution, Paid Time Off, Holidays, and Birthday off with pay will be provided.
